Beyond the numbers

What each city asks you to trade

Costs and scores help narrow the choice. These practical strengths and limitations finish the picture.

Bansko Bulgaria

Strengths

  • Low living costs compared with major European nomad hubs
  • Strong international remote-worker community
  • Excellent access to skiing, hiking, and mountain biking
  • Walkable center with many cafΓ©s and restaurants
  • Reliable fiber internet in most modern buildings
  • Generally safe and relaxed small-town atmosphere

Trade-offs

  • Very cold, snowy winters outside ski-season activities
  • Limited healthcare facilities and specialist care
  • Seasonal crowds and higher rents during ski season
  • Small town can feel isolated for long stays
  • Public transport connections are limited
  • English is less common away from tourism businesses

Common visa routes

  • Schengen short-stay visa or visa-free entry for eligible nationalities, up to 90 days in any 180-day period
  • Bulgarian long-stay D visa for qualifying workers, students, family members, or investors
  • EU/EEA/Swiss freedom of movement with local registration for stays over three months
Sofia Bulgaria

Strengths

  • Affordable European capital with comparatively low daily costs
  • Fast, widely available fiber internet and strong mobile coverage
  • Walkable central districts with a useful metro and tram network
  • Large mountain park and easy hiking access close to the center
  • Growing coworking, startup, and international remote-worker scene
  • Excellent base for affordable travel around the Balkans and Europe

Trade-offs

  • Winter air pollution can be severe, especially during temperature inversions
  • Traffic and parking are difficult during weekday rush hours
  • Bureaucracy can be slow and Bulgarian-language heavy
  • Social attitudes toward LGBTQ+ people remain relatively conservative
  • Older apartments may have poor insulation or costly electric heating
  • Sidewalk maintenance and accessibility vary substantially by neighborhood

Common visa routes

  • Schengen short-stay visa or visa-free entry: up to 90 days in any 180-day period
  • Bulgarian Type D long-stay visa followed by a residence permit
  • EU/EEA/Swiss freedom of movement registration for longer stays
